CVE-2018-1062: A vulnerability was discovered in oVirt 4.1.x before 4.1.9, where the combination of Enable Discard and Wip...

A vulnerability was discovered in oVirt 4.1.x before 4.1.9, where the combination of Enable Discard and Wipe After Delete flags for VM disks managed by oVirt, could cause a disk to be incompletely zeroed when removed from a VM. If the same storage blocks happen to be later allocated to a new disk attached to another VM, potentially sensitive data could be revealed to privileged users of that VM.

oVirt could fail to fully clear data from a removed VM disk when specific disk options were used. If those storage blocks were later reused for another VM, a privileged user in that VM could see leftover sensitive data from the prior VM. Exposure is limited to oVirt 4.1.x before 4.1.9 using the affected disk flag combination. Risk is higher in shared or multi-tenant virtualization environments where storage blocks are reused across VMs. Prioritize remediation for shared virtualization platforms, especially where different users, teams, or tenants share storage. This is not described as remotely exploitable, but it can undermine data separation guarantees. Mitigation focus: Upgrade affected oVirt 4.1.x deployments to 4.1.9 or later where applicable.; Review Red Hat advisory RHBA-2018:0135 for vendor-specific remediation guidance.; Identify VM disks using both Enable Discard and Wipe After Delete..
